STRecruiting Notebook 2-12: Desmond Green finalizes more official visits; Jaylen McGill is back on the market

Timberland OT Desmond Green has set up three more official visits per Sam Spiegelman of Rivals. He has Virginia Tech April 11th, Oklahoma June 6th and Florida June 13th. He already has visits set with Georgia May 30th and USC June 20th. RB Jaylen McGill of Mountain View Prep decommitted from Rutgers on Wednesday morning.

STRecruiting Notebook 2-10: Top OT target set to announce this month; more official visits are being set up

Clemson and USC target OT Bear McWhorter has set February 28th for his commitment announcement. McWhorter has a final five of Clemson, USC, Alabama, Florida and Michigan.
